Changeset 2465 for GTP/trunk/App/Demos


Ignore:
Timestamp:
06/25/07 15:41:04 (17 years ago)
Author:
szirmay
Message:
 
File:
1 edited

Legend:

Unmodified
Added
Removed
  • GTP/trunk/App/Demos/Illum/Ogre/src/Common/src/FPSPlayer.cpp

    r2462 r2465  
    7979                 mFireBallLight->setPowerScale(200); 
    8080                 mFireBallLight->setAttenuation(200.0, 0, 0, 6);         
     81                 mFireBallLight->setVisible(false); 
    8182 
    8283                 attachNode = meshNode->createChildSceneNode(name + "_AttachNode"); 
    8384                 fireBallNode = attachNode->createChildSceneNode(name + "_FireBallNode"); 
     85                // fireBallNode->attachObject(mFireBallLight); 
     86                 BillboardSet* bbs = ((BillboardParticleRenderer*)mFireBall->getRenderer())->getBillboardSet(); 
    8487                 fireBallNode->attachObject(mFireBall); 
    85                  //fireBallNode->attachObject(mFireBallLight); 
    86                  BillboardSet* bbs = ((BillboardParticleRenderer*)mFireBall->getRenderer())->getBillboardSet(); 
    8788                 bbs->setMaterialName(mFireBall->getMaterialName()); 
    8889                        OgreIlluminationManager::getSingleton().initTechniques( 
     
    9091                                mFireBall); 
    9192                 fireBallNode->detachObject(mFireBall); 
     93                 mFireBall->setVisible(false); 
    9294                 sceneManager = sm; 
    9395                 this->attachBone = attachBone; 
     
    146148   { 
    147149           isActive = true; 
     150           mFireBall->setVisible(true); 
     151          // mFireBallLight->setVisible(true); 
    148152           fireBallNode->attachObject(mFireBall); 
    149153           fireBallNode->attachObject(mFireBallLight); 
     
    160164           fireBallNode->detachObject(mFireBallLight);      
    161165           //mFireBallLight->setPowerScale(0); 
     166            mFireBall->setVisible(false); 
     167        //   mFireBallLight->setVisible(false); 
    162168           CompositorManager::getSingleton().setCompositorEnabled( 
    163169                   OgreIlluminationManager::getSingleton().getMainViewport(), 
Note: See TracChangeset for help on using the changeset viewer.